温馨提示:这篇文章已超过633天没有更新,请注意相关的内容是否还可用!
摘要:MySQL服务器连接问题解析,针对本地主机连接失败(错误代码10061)问题,提供解决指南。可能原因包括MySQL服务未启动、防火墙设置阻止连接等。解决方案包括检查MySQL服务状态、调整防火墙设置等。无法连接本地主机时,需检查网络配置和MySQL服务器配置,确保正确设置端口和权限。
解析MySQL服务器连接问题,遇到无法连接本地主机并显示错误代码10061的情况,这可能是由于MySQL服务未启动、端口配置错误或防火墙设置导致,本文提供解决指南,包括检查MySQL服务状态、确认端口号是否正确、调整防火墙设置等方面,按照步骤操作,可解决本地主机连接失败的问题,成功连接到MySQL服务器。
问题概述
当尝试从本地主机连接MySQL服务器时,可能会遇到无法连接的问题,通常会伴随错误代码10061,这个问题可能由以下几个原因引发:MySQL服务未启动、防火墙阻止连接或配置错误。
解决方法
1、检查并启动MySQL服务:
通过控制面板进入管理工具,找到服务并检查MySQL服务的状态。
如果服务未启动,尝试手动启动服务。
2、检查防火墙设置:
确保防火墙允许通过MySQL服务器的端口进行连接请求。
如果是Linux系统,修改iptables防火墙来开放指定端口;如果是其他系统,确保相关防火墙设置允许MySQL连接。
3、检查MySQL配置文件:
核实MySQL配置文件(如my.cnf)中的绑定地址和端口设置是否正确无误。
找到MySQL的socket套接字文件位置,并根据需要调整相关配置。
4、解决任务管理器中MySQL相关内容被删除的问题:
尝试关闭防火墙并重新安装MySQL。
如有必要,重启计算机,停用IIS并清理temp文件夹。
在配置MySQL时,注意更改服务名并确保相关端口已开放。
5、解决phpMyAdmin无法连接到MySQL服务器的问题:
核对配置文件中的主机名、用户名和密码是否正确无误。
使用mysql workbench等工具测试配置并尝试连接MySQL。
注意:在连接MySQL时,需明确localhost和127.0.0.1的区别,localhost表示本地服务器,不受网络限制。
三、针对mysql服务器无法连接本地主机问题的具体解决方法
1、排除网络或防火墙问题:
尝试ping通远程服务器,以检查网络连接状况。
确认MySQL服务的端口是否被防火墙阻挡。
2、配置防火墙以允许连接:
检查并确保MySQL已授权指定主机的用户进行连接。
提供的解决方案仅供参考,建议根据实际情况进行调试和修改,若问题仍未解决,建议寻求专业人士的帮助,观看MySQL视频教程可以获取更多细节和解决方法。
还没有评论,来说两句吧...